Reassure me I am not a jerk re: my seat
Post Flair (click to view more posts with a particular flair)
Post Body

Today on the NER I boarded at Philly. I booked this trip 6 weeks ago. I am traveling solo for the first time in a long time and successfully recovering from an anxiety disorder. Because of that, I booked a window seat because for numerous reasons it helps me be way less anxious.

When I boarded (business class) a woman was in my seat. She was completely set up with the tray table down and a laptop as well as a few other devices set up and plugged in.

I said hi and pointed out she was in my seat. She waved towards the seat next to her (the aisle seat) and said “yeah this one is open, its mine you can just sit there.” I said, “no thanks because that’s actually my seat.” She gave me the dirtiest look and rolled her eyes, again telling me the (her) aisle seat is free. I said I know but I want my seat please.

She unplugged everything and made a production out of letting me in and switching seats. I paid a lot of money for that seat and booked 6 weeks ago. But the recovering people pleaser in me wants reassurance that I was NTA.
